The size of Brunswick East is approximately 2.2 square kilometres. There are 18 parks, covering nearly 15.2% of the total area. The population of Brunswick East in 2016 was 11504 people. By 2021 the population was 13279 showing a population growth of 15.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brunswick East is 30-39 years. Households in Brunswick East are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brunswick East work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.60% of the homes in Brunswick East were owner-occupied compared with 42.50% in 2016.
